Wildcat basketball camp and clinics

Under the guidance of Oak Harbor High School girls basketball coaches and members of the team, young players in grades first through sixth are invited to attend the Wildcat Basketball Camp and Clinics for girl athletes beginning Tuesday, June 23, at North Whidbey Middle School.

The three-day basketball camp is Tuesday, June 23, through Thursday, June 25, and the three clinics will be held July 7, 14 and 28.

Both the camp and the clinics are from 11:30 a.m. to 1 p.m.

The cost is $25 to attend the camp and $25 to attend the clinics, but the best bargain is $40 for both.

Campers returning their registrations no later than June 10 will also receive a T-shirt.

The camp and clinics are for players of all skill levels and will serve as a great way to have some fun this summer while working on your game.

Registrations may be picked up at Big 5 Sporting Goods or either 7-Eleven stores in Oak Harbor.
